Best Aquatic Shop in London. This place is located on Romford Road, Monor Park. Free parking outside, pay and display nearby, 5 minute walk from Manor Park Station. A huge range of:
- tropical fish
- sea water fish
- turtles
- coral
- crabs
- fish tanks
- cleaning liquids
- fish food and autofeeders
- filters and pumps
- tank decoration items
- all accessories

The list is endless and so is the choice. The most impressive thing about this 30 year old family business is the knowledge. The owner Dee really knows his stuff. He has a passion for water creatures and will give you the best advice.
